Complete guide to Aberdeen

Things to do in Aberdeen

Discover the best of Aberdeen — top attractions, local food, transport tips, budget advice, and currency essentials. Plan your perfect Aberdeen trip today.

  • Must visit

Aberdeen Art Gallery

Aberdeen's main art museum with strong Scottish collections, decorative arts, and major temporary exhibitions in a restored building.

  • Must visit

Aberdeen Maritime Museum

Interactive maritime museum on the harbour, covering shipbuilding, fishing, and the offshore industry with excellent harbour views.

  • Recommended

Aberdeen Science Centre

Award-winning museum of North Sea oil and gas, with interactive displays on offshore platforms, energy history, and future technology.

Pound sterling (£)

Moderate for the UK. Hotels can be pricey in peak periods, but dining and local transit are usually manageable for most tourists.

Average meal costs

Budget
£8-15 for fast food or a simple meal.
Mid-range
£18-35 per person for a restaurant meal.
Fine dining
£60+ per person for upscale dining.
Coffee
£3-4.50 for a cappuccino.

Tipping culture

Tipping is optional. In restaurants, 10-12.5% is common if service is not included. Round up for taxis; cafes usually do not expect tips.

The currency used in the United Kingdom is the British Pound Sterling (GBP). For travelers, using a card is generally more convenient and widely accepted, especially in cities and for transportation tickets, though carrying some cash can be useful for small purchases or in rural areas.
In Aberdeen,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as and public transport. Scams involving overcharging by taxis can occur, so it's advisable to use licensed cabs or pre-book rides. Additionally, travelers should be aware of occasional distraction tactics used to divert attention while belongings are stolen. Staying vigilant and securing personal items helps ensure a safe visit.
